Release of Academic Information and Your Rights to Privacy

(Buckley Amendment and FERPA)

Information regarding your rights to privacy, and information regarding data regarded as "directory" information may be found in the Student Handbook.

For questions about your right to privacy and information that may be released to the public, please contact the Office of Student Affairs, (970) 943-2011. The Office of the Registrar follows the federal regulations regarding student privacy. We cannot give out academic information over the phone, including grades or GPA. We will not give out any academic information to anyone who is not the student without the student's written permission. This restriction also includes parents.

If you wish to have your grades sent to your parents, please fill out the Authorization for Release of Academic Information form and submit it to the Office of Student Affairs in Taylor 301 for processing.

GraduationReplacement Diploma Requests

The Office of the Registrar does not store diploma copies. If your original diploma was lost, stolen, or damaged you may submit a Replacement Diploma Request.

The attendance and graduation of the person in question will be verified by the Registrar’s Office.

Replacement diplomas are available for $20, and will be issued in the name under which the student attended. If the name has legally changed, documentation must be provided, and the student record will be updated accordingly. Originals or notarized copies of one of the following must be presented for identification:

    • Current Driver's License
    • Passport
    • Birth Certificate

The replacement diploma may not be exactly identical to the original.

Verification of Enrollment/Degree

The Registrar's Office at Western is able to provide the following types of verification:

  • Enrollment Status:  Western State Colorado University has authorized the National Student Clearinghouse to provide enrollment verifications.  This enables student service providers to verify enrollment for students 24/7.  Verifications may be used for multiple purposes, including insurance coverage, loan deferments, student discounts, internships, scholarship and visa applications, as well as Study Abroad programs. 

As a student, you may access FREE Student Self-Service:

1. Log into your MyWSCU account at http://www.western.edu/inside/students

2. Click on: Student -> Student Records -> Enrollment Verification
